Fossil fuel consumption in Vanuatu
Vanuatu: Fossil fuel consumption was 1.33 terawatt-hours in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Fossil fuel consumption in Vanuatu, 1980–2024
Source: Energy Institute - Statistical Review of World Energy (2026) and other sources – with major processing by Our World in Data. Measured in terawatt-hours.
Analysis
In 2024, fossil fuel consumption in Vanuatu stood at 1.33 terawatt-hours. That is the highest value across all 45 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 5.6% on the previous year and up 90.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, fossil fuel consumption in Vanuatu peaked at 1.33 terawatt-hours in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.2117 terawatt-hours, in 1993.
Vanuatu ranks 192nd of 214 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 0.4797 terawatt-hours | 0.4265 terawatt-hours | 0.5526 terawatt-hours | 10 |
| 1990s | 0.2583 terawatt-hours | 0.2117 terawatt-hours | 0.4839 terawatt-hours | 10 |
| 2000s | 0.4614 terawatt-hours | 0.3556 terawatt-hours | 0.657 terawatt-hours | 10 |
| 2010s | 0.7307 terawatt-hours | 0.6125 terawatt-hours | 0.9481 terawatt-hours | 10 |
| 2020s | 1.18 terawatt-hours | 1.06 terawatt-hours | 1.33 terawatt-hours | 5 |
